Operators on function spaces acting by composition to the right with a fixed self-map ϕ are called composition operators. We denote them Cϕ. Given ϕ, a hyperbolic disc automorphism, the composition operator Cϕ on the Hilbert Hardy space H2 is considered. The bilateral cyclic invariant subspaces Kf, f ∈ H2, of Cϕ are studied, given their connection with the invariant subspace problem, which is still open for Hilbert space operators. In this note, we study topologically transitive and hypercyclic composition operators on $C_p(X)$ or $C_k(X)$. We prove that if $G$ is a semigroup of continuous self maps of a countable metric space $X$ with the following properties: (1) every element of $G$ is one-to-one on $X$, (2) the action of $G$ is strongly run-away on $X$, then the action of $\hat{G}$ on $C_p(X)$ is topologically transitive and hypercyclic. If $G$ is the set of all one-to-one and continuous self maps of $\mathbb{R}\setminus \mathbb{Z}$, then the action of $\hat{G}$ on $C_k(\mathbb{R}\setminus \mathbb{Z})$ is hypercyclic.
